After School’s Lizzy To Make Solo Debut With Trot Track Early Next Year

According to reports in the Korean media earlier this week, After School singer Lizzy will be making her solo debut next year.

The vocalist's debut single will reportedly be a trot style song, not a common move in the modern K-pop scene. Considered to be Korea's oldest pop music form, trot is believed to date back to the early 1900s.

It also appears to have a special place in the After School vocalist's heart.

Lizzy once admitted on "Three Wheels" that she had been accepted into After School after singing a trot song at the audition.

Lizzy first entered After School in 2010. She also was a part of the side project Orange Caramel, with her After School bandmates Raina and Nana. The group received significant attention in Korea and Japan.

In 2011 she made her acting debut in the MBC drama, “All My Love.” In 2012, she was cast for the MBC drama, “Rascal Sons.” Most recently, it has been confirmed that she will be appearing in the movie  “Love Forecast.”
